App stores are a convenient and secure marketplace for both developers and consumers.
App stores are a convenient way for developers to market their software and for consumers to find it. They check apps for malware, offer secure transactions and payments systems, and provide marketing tools. They also assist developers in making informed decisions about their products by providing feedback from users. However, they are also in competition from other sources of software distribution such as direct downloads and brick-and-mortar stores.
Most app stores require that all software be reviewed before it can be placed in their store. This can include a thorough code inspection to ensure it is compatible with the operating system requirements and the device. This can also include a review to determine if the app is appropriate for the intended audience. This ensures that only high-quality applications are available to download. The apps are then digitally signed to protect the apps from being altered without the store operator's knowledge and approval.
The app store will generally arrange its software according to type of device and function (e.g. games, multimedia, productivity, etc.). It will also automate updates, and permit the installation of certain applications. It also relieves users from worrying about technical aspects such as compatibility with their hardware and software configuration.

App stores need to overcome many obstacles to be successful. Some of them are technical, like making sure the infrastructure is secure and scalable enough to handle large volumes of downloads and installations. Other issues are more social in nature and include providing a trusted environment for customers and developers to communicate. These challenges can be mitigated through a strong brand and guidelines that developers have to follow to be eligible for inclusion in an app store.
Developers can employ a variety of strategies to generate app store revenue, such as in-app purchases and advertising. In-app purchases are a simple method of earning money for app developers, whereas advertisements are frequently used to increasing the exposure of free apps. App stores also provide an array of analytics to help developers better understand the user's behavior and track performance. They also provide an explanation of the payment schedule, which outlines the dates that developers can expect to receive payment for their apps.
